TFT CUDA Tensor Contiguity Fix (Agent 142) - Fixed "matmul not supported for non-contiguous tensors" error - Added .contiguous() call after narrow() operation in QuantileLayer - Enabled CUDA-accelerated TFT training - **Files**: ml/src/tft/quantile_outputs.rs ### 4. MAMBA-2 CUDA Layer Normalization (Agent 145) - Created CudaLayerNorm wrapper for missing CUDA kernel - Implemented manual layer norm: γ * (x - μ) / sqrt(σ² + ε) + β - MAMBA-2 now runs on CUDA (no more "no cuda implementation" error) - **Files**: ml/src/mamba/mod.rs ### 5. ### Scenario 1: Memory >90% (CRITICAL)
|
|
|
|
**Alert Output**:
|
|
```
|
|
🚨 MEMORY ALERT: 92% usage exceeds 90% threshold!
|
|
Available: 2048MB
|
|
Top 5 memory consumers:
|
|
- rustc (PID 12345): 15.2%
|
|
- train_liquid_dbn (PID 23456): 12.8%
|
|
- postgres (PID 34567): 5.3%
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Recommendations**:
|
|
1. Kill non-essential processes (Chrome, Firefox, Slack)
|
|
2. Reduce batch size in training configuration
|
|
3. Enable gradient checkpointing
|
|
4. Use mixed precision (fp16) training
|
|
|
|
**Emergency Command**:
|
|
```bash
|
|
# Kill non-essential processes
|
|
pkill -f 'chrome|firefox|slack' 2>/dev/null || true
|
|
|
|
# Clear page cache (safe, no data loss)
|
|
sudo sync && sudo sh -c 'echo 3 > /proc/sys/vm/drop_caches'
|
|
|
|
# Emergency: Kill largest memory consumer
|
|
kill -9 $(ps aux --sort=-%mem | awk 'NR==2 {print $2}')
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
### Scenario 2: Swap >6GB (WARNING)
|
|
|
|
**Alert Output**:
|
|
```
|
|
🚨 SWAP ALERT: 6500MB usage exceeds 6144MB threshold!
|
|
System is likely thrashing - performance severely degraded
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Recommendations**:
|
|
1. System is thrashing (reading from disk instead of RAM)
|
|
2. Kill largest memory consumer immediately
|
|
3. Restart training with reduced batch size
|
|
|
|
**Emergency Command**:
|
|
```bash
|
|
# Kill training processes
|
|
pkill -f 'train_liquid|optuna'
|
|
|
|
# Wait for swap to clear
|
|
sleep 30
|
|
|
|
# Reduce batch size and restart
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
### Scenario 3: Disk >85% (WARNING)
|
|
|
|
**Alert Output**:
|
|
```
|
|
⚠️ DISK ALERT: 88% usage exceeds 85% threshold!
|
|
Available: 20G
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Recommendations**:
|
|
1. Clean up old checkpoints
|
|
2. Remove old logs (>7 days)
|
|
3. Clean cargo cache
|
|
4. Remove Docker volumes
|
|
|
|
**Cleanup Commands**:
|
|
```bash
|
|
# Clean old checkpoints
|
|
rm -rf ml/tuning_checkpoints/trial_*/checkpoint_epoch_*
|
|
|
|
# Remove old logs
|
|
find . -name '*.log' -mtime +7 -delete
|
|
|
|
# Clean cargo cache
|
|
cargo clean
|
|
|
|
# Check space again
|
|
df -h /
|
|
```

## Optimization Recommendations
|
|
|
|
### Memory Optimization
|
|
|
|
1. **Batch Size Tuning**:
|
|
- Memory <50%: Increase batch size by 50%
|
|
- Memory 50-80%: Current batch size is optimal
|
|
- Memory >80%: Reduce batch size by 50%
|
|
|
|
2. **Gradient Checkpointing**:
|
|
- Enable for MAMBA-2/TFT models if memory >70%
|
|
- Trades 30% more compute for 50% less memory
|
|
- Implementation: Add `gradient_checkpointing=True` to model config
|
|
|
|
3. **Mixed Precision**:
|
|
- Use fp16 instead of fp32 to halve memory usage
|
|
- Minimal accuracy impact (<0.5% for most models)
|
|
- Implementation: Add `--mixed-precision` flag to training
|
|
|
|
### Swap Optimization
|
|
|
|
1. **Increase Physical RAM**: If swap >2GB consistently, consider RAM upgrade
|
|
2. **Reduce Batch Size**: Swap usage indicates memory pressure
|
|
3. **Enable zswap**: Compressed swap in memory (faster than disk)
|
|
|
|
### Disk Optimization
|
|
|
|
1. **Checkpoint Management**: Keep only last 3 epochs
|
|
2. **Log Rotation**: Archive logs older than 7 days
|
|
3. **Cargo Cache**: Clean after major builds
|
|
4. **Docker Pruning**: Remove unused images/volumes weekly
